Firewall Geo-IP Blocking Legitimate Traffic: Fix It

Misconfigured Geo-IP blocking on your firewall can lock out users or partners. Here's how to find and fix the three most common mistakes.

Quick-Reference Summary Table

CauseSymptomFix
Wrong country codeTraffic from a specific country is blocked incorrectlyVerify ISO code, correct it in the rule
Outdated Geo-IP databaseBlocked country traffic gets through sporadicallyUpdate the Geo-IP database; enable auto-updates
Block rule after an allow ruleBlocked country traffic still passesMove block rule above any general allow rules
